A new system for spinning nanofibers that should offer significant productivity increases while drastically reducing power consumption has been designed by MIT research scientists.
Nanofibers — strands of material only a couple hundred nanometers in diameter — have a huge range of possible applications: scaffolds for bioengineered organs, ultrafine air and water filters, and lightweight Kevlar body armor, to name just a few. But so far, the… read more
